Output a23f33ef141ba704a8682519d59791a27a197d61595aea1342d42f14bb144206:8

value
22469139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d26b2b24f8d82400ef7822265116e785b08584 OP_EQUAL
address
M7yWJaAqTodXqdcoSA6H7nU23oHvccJKa5
transaction
a23f33ef141ba704a8682519d59791a27a197d61595aea1342d42f14bb144206
spent
true